单文档应用程序设计
单文档应用程序设计
主要内容 基本MFC应用程序框架 学会使用 Class Wizard 在MFC应用程序中实现简单 的文字输入输出
主要内容 •基本MFC应用程序框架 •在MFC应用程序中实现简单 的文字输入输出 •学会使用ClassWizard
基本MFC应用程序框架 基本C++程序框架 #include <iostream. h> void main cout<< Hello c++'<<endl
基本MFC应用程序框架 •基本C++程序框架 #include <iostream.h> void main() { cout<<“Hello C++”<<endl; }
基本MFC程序框架 从 App Wizard向导开始 ●●●●●● CObject CCmdTarget CWin Thread CDocument CWnd CWinApp CFrameWnd CView CHelloApp CHelloDoc CMain Frame CHelloview
基本MFC程序框架 从AppWizard向导开始…… CObject CCmdTarget CWinThread CDocument CWinApp CFrameWnd CView CWnd CHelloApp CHelloDoc CMainFrame CHelloView
WinMain函数在哪里??? 封装 Winmain CWinApp Registerclass(; virtual BOOL InitApplication o; CreatWindow (i Show Window(…)}- Avirtual BOOL Initinstanceo; pdateWindow(… virtual int Run o: WinProc7封装 CFrameWnd
WinMain函数在哪里??? WinMain CWinApp 封装 RegisterClass(…); CreatWindow(…); ShowWindow(…); UpdateWindow(…); virtual BOOL InitApplication(); virtual BOOL InitInstance(); virtual int Run(); WinProc CFrameWnd 封装